Safety first: essential precautions

Safety is the top priority when dealing with propane heaters. Always work in a well-ventilated area and never operate a valve or burner if you smell gas. Before any inspection, turn off the heater and disconnect electrical power if the unit has a powered ignition. Use a portable gas detector or soapy water to test for leaks after any adjustment. If you notice hissing sounds, strong gas odors, or flame rollbacks, evacuate and contact emergency services. Wearing eye protection and gloves helps shield you from sharp edges and hot surfaces. The tricky part of propane systems is that small leaks or improper venting can lead to dangerous buildup, so proceed with caution and document every step for future reference.

Key takeaway: never rush or bypass safety checks; incorrect handling can cause fire or CO exposure.

Diagnosing common problems and quick checks

Propane heater issues fall into several common patterns. Ignition failures can stem from a dirty pilot or faulty ignition components. Thermostat or limit switch malfunctions may prevent firing or cause short cycling. Gas supply problems can arise from empty tanks, clogged lines, or a failing regulator. Pay attention to symptoms like uneven heat, unusual odors, weak flames, or frequent shutdowns. Start with non-invasive checks: verify the propane level, inspect external connections for corrosion, and ensure the exhaust vent is clear. If the unit is equipped with a pilot light, confirm it stays lit and that the thermocouple is properly positioned.

Document each symptom with a checklist and test results before proceeding to more invasive steps. When in doubt, err on the side of caution and seek professional evaluation to avoid dangerous missteps.

Cleaning, maintenance, and airflow considerations

Regular cleaning and airflow management can prevent many failures. Remove debris around the burner and ensure the intake vent is free of dust. Clean the burner ports with a soft brush and never use metal tools that could damage the jets. Check the ignition system for wear and replace a corroded thermocouple or dirty electrodes. Keep a consistent maintenance schedule, including annual professional inspections. Adequate combustion requires proper venting; verify that the vent pipe is not restricted and that exterior exhaust termination is free of obstructions.

Addressing airflow issues improves efficiency and prolongs component life. Poor combustion due to restricted air supply can produce soot and carbon monoxide, making routine checks critical for safety.

When to call a pro and how to choose one

Some propane heater problems are best handled by a licensed technician, especially those involving gas lines, regulators, or CO risks. If you smell gas, hear hissing, or detect persistent error codes after basic checks, call a qualified technician immediately. When selecting a pro, verify licensing and insurance, request a written estimate with scope and parts, and ask about warranty terms. Seek technicians experienced with propane systems and the specific heater model you own. A good contractor will provide a transparent diagnosis, outline repair options, and explain maintenance steps to prevent recurrence.

Parts replacement and sourcing guidance

DIY parts replacement can be feasible for simple items like thermocouples, spark electrodes, or minor burner cleaning. However, ensure you purchase OEM-recommended parts compatible with your heater model. Keep the model and serial number handy when ordering parts, and compare prices across reputable suppliers. If a major component such as the regulator or heat exchanger shows wear, assess the cost of replacement against buying a new unit. In all cases, use proper torque specifications and pneumatic or gas-rated tools to avoid leaks and damage.

Steps

Estimated time: 45-90 minutes

  1. 1

    Identify symptoms and secure the area

    Turn off the heater and disconnect power if applicable. Note all symptoms and verify there is no gas smell. Document when the issue occurs and any preceding events.

    Tip: Take photos of connections before touching anything for reference.
  2. 2

    Check propane supply and regulator

    Ensure the propane tank is adequately filled and that the line is not kinked. Inspect the regulator for signs of wear and test pressure if you have the proper gauge.

    Tip: Replace a weak regulator rather than adjusting it—pressure problems can be dangerous.
  3. 3

    Inspect pilot light and thermocouple

    If the pilot stays lit inconsistently, clean the pilot or replace the thermocouple if corroded. Realign or replace a bent thermocouple so it properly senses flame.

    Tip: Only clean the pilot with a soft brush or cloth; avoid forcing jets.
  4. 4

    Evaluate ignition system and sensors

    Check ignition electrodes for carbon buildup or misalignment. Ensure wiring is intact and securely connected; replace damaged cables if needed.

    Tip: A sparking gap should be within manufacturer specifications; consult the manual.
  5. 5

    Test for gas leaks after adjustments

    Apply soap solution to joints and connections; watch for bubbles that indicate leaks. Never rely on smell alone to detect leaks.

    Tip: If bubbles appear, shut off gas immediately and re-check or call a pro.
  6. 6

    Clean burner surfaces and reassemble

    Gently clean burner ports, air intake, and surfaces with a soft brush. Reassemble panels and ensure all fasteners are snug but not overtightened.

    Tip: Avoid using metal tools that can scratch the burner or cause damage.
  7. 7

    Power up and perform a controlled test

    Restore power and ignite the unit in a controlled area. Observe flame behavior and listen for abnormal operation while monitoring for gas smells.

    Tip: If you see soot, yellow flames, or frequent shutdowns, stop and seek professional help.

Got Questions?

Is propane heater repair safe for DIY?

DIY repairs can be safe for simple tasks like cleaning and part replacement when you have the right tools and follow the manufacturer’s instructions. For gas lines, regulators, ignition problems, or persistent CO risks, hire a licensed technician.

How can I tell if I need a replacement regulator?

If you experience inconsistent flame, weak heat, or the system cycles abnormally, the regulator may be failing. A professional should verify expected outlet pressure and proper gas flow before replacement.

Can I test propane leaks myself?

Yes. Use a soap solution on all joints and connections while the system is off. If bubbles appear while the system is on, shut off the gas and call a pro. Do not rely on smell alone.
